misprint

/ˈmɪsprɪnt/

Definitions

1. noun

A mistake in printing, especially a misprinted word or character in a book, newspaper, etc.

“The book contained several misprints that had to be corrected before it was published.”

2. verb

To print incorrectly or with errors

“The typist misprinted the entire page and had to retype it.”
